What does the document identifier AU1 signify?

Explanation:
The document identifier AU1 signifies a reply to the shipper regarding material that has been shipped. This identifier indicates a formal communication acknowledging the receipt of materials, providing the shipper with important information about the status of their shipment. In logistical operations, it's essential to maintain clear and effective communication to ensure that all parties are informed about the processing and handling of goods. The AU1 identifier serves as a standard reference for tracking correspondence related to shipped materials, which helps in aligning expectations and facilitates any necessary follow-up actions. Understanding the specific function of document identifiers like AU1 is crucial for Logistics Specialists, as it aids in maintaining accurate records and enhancing the efficiency of the supply chain management process.
